Understanding the Landscape of Starting a Business in India


India is one of the fastest-growing economies globally, with a vibrant startup ecosystem and a welcoming environment for foreign investment. However, navigating the regulatory framework can be complex. Here’s what you need to know:


  • Legal Structures: You can choose from several business entities such as Private Limited Company, Limited Liability Partnership (LLP), or Branch Office. Each has its own compliance and tax implications.

  • Regulatory Bodies: The Ministry of Corporate Affairs (MCA), Reserve Bank of India (RBI), and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I) play key roles in business regulation.

  • Taxation: India offers competitive tax rates, especially in SEZs like GIFT City, where you can benefit from tax holidays and exemptions.

  • Ease of Doing Business: India has improved significantly in global rankings, but understanding local laws and procedures remains essential.


GIFT City stands out as a strategic location for foreign entrepreneurs. It offers a business-friendly environment with world-class infrastructure, regulatory benefits, and access to global financial markets.

Why Choose GIFT City for Your Business Setup?


GIFT City is designed to be a global financial hub, offering several advantages for foreign entrepreneurs:


  • IFSC Benefits: GIFT City operates as an International Financial Services Centre, allowing businesses to conduct international financial services with regulatory ease.

  • Tax Incentives: Enjoy exemptions on income tax, securities transaction tax, and stamp duty for a specified period.

  • Regulatory Framework: The International Financial Services Centres Authority (IFSCA) governs GIFT City, providing a single-window clearance system and simplified compliance.

  • Access to Capital: GIFT City supports various fundraising options including External Commercial Borrowings (ECB), Special Purpose Acquisition Companies (SPACs), bonds, and Alternative Investment Funds (AIFs).

  • Global Investment Structuring: Use GIFT City as a base for structuring global investments efficiently.


These features make GIFT City an ideal choice for fintech startups, venture capitalists, fund managers, and global investors looking to tap into the Indian market.

Can a NRI Start a Business in India?


Yes, Non-Resident Indians (NRIs) can start and operate businesses in India. The government has simplified procedures to encourage NRIs to invest and contribute to the economy. Here are some key points:


  • Entity Options: NRIs can register a Private Limited Company, LLP, or even a sole proprietorship under certain conditions.

  • Foreign Direct Investment (FDI): NRIs are allowed 100% FDI in most sectors under the automatic route, meaning no prior government approval is required.

  • Banking and Finance: NRIs can open Non-Resident External (NRE) and Non-Resident Ordinary (NRO) accounts to manage business funds.

  • Compliance: NRIs must comply with the Companies Act, RBI regulations, and tax laws applicable to their business structure.

  • GIFT City Advantage: NRIs can leverage GIFT City’s IFSC benefits to optimize tax and regulatory compliance.


If you are an NRI considering business opportunities in India, GIFT City offers a streamlined and supportive environment to launch and grow your venture.


Step-by-Step Guide to Setting Up Your Business in GIFT City


Starting your business in GIFT City involves several steps. Here’s a simplified roadmap to help you get started:


  1. Choose Your Business Entity

    Decide whether you want to register a Private Limited Company, LLP, or Branch Office. Each has different compliance requirements.


  2. Name Reservation and Registration

    Reserve your company name with the Ministry of Corporate Affairs and file incorporation documents.


  3. Obtain Necessary Licenses

    Depending on your business activity, you may need licenses from IFSCA, SEZ authorities, or other regulators.


  4. Open Bank Accounts

    Open corporate bank accounts in GIFT City to manage your finances efficiently.


  5. Comply with Tax and Regulatory Requirements

    Register for Goods and Services Tax (GST), Income Tax, and other applicable taxes. Ensure ongoing compliance with IFSCA and SEZ rules.


  6. Explore Fundraising Options

    Utilize GIFT City’s facilities for raising capital through ECBs, SPACs, bonds, or AIFs.

Fundraising and Investment Structuring in GIFT City


One of the biggest advantages of GIFT City is its support for diverse fundraising mechanisms and global investment structuring:


  • External Commercial Borrowings (ECB): Raise foreign currency loans with flexible terms and lower costs.

  • Special Purpose Acquisition Companies (SPACs): Use SPACs to access capital markets efficiently.

  • Bonds and Debt Instruments: Issue bonds under favorable regulatory conditions.

  • Alternative Investment Funds (AIFs): Set up and manage AIFs to pool investments from global investors.


GIFT City’s regulatory framework allows you to structure investments in a tax-efficient manner, reducing costs and enhancing returns. This is particularly beneficial for fintechs, venture capitalists, and family offices looking to expand their footprint in India.
